Agentforce hits $100M ARR as Salesforce bets on AI-powered digital workforce

Share via:


A quiet revolution is brewing inside Salesforce. One that doesn’t just rely on large language models or flashy chatbot demos, but on building a digital workforce powered by intelligent, autonomous agents. The company’s ambitious target? One billion agents deployed across global enterprises.

Madhav Thattai, SVP and COO of Agentforce, Salesforce’s new platform for agentic AI, believes the enterprise world is on the cusp of a major shift. “We think the workforces of the future are going to be hybrid — humans and agents working together,”…
